Understanding Natural Food Coloring
Natural food coloring is derived from edible sources such as fruits, vegetables, and spices. The process involves extracting pigments from these sources to incorporate vibrant hues into various food products, including cookie dough. Unlike synthetic food coloring that may contain artificial additives, natural food coloring offers a more wholesome and environmentally friendly alternative.
When using natural food coloring for cookie dough, it is essential to understand the different options available. Some common choices include beet powder for a rich red hue, matcha powder for a vibrant green, turmeric for a bold yellow, and freeze-dried berry powders for various shades of pink and purple. By experimenting with these natural options, you can create a spectrum of colors while ensuring that your cookie dough is free from artificial additives.

Tips For Achieving Vibrant Colors
Achieving vibrant colors in naturally colored cookie dough can be a delightful and rewarding experience. To ensure your cookie dough shines with vivid hues, start by using high-quality natural coloring agents such as matcha powder, beet powder, turmeric, or spirulina. These ingredients not only add color but also bring unique flavors and health benefits to your treats.
Another important tip is to start with a small amount of coloring agent and gradually add more until you reach your desired shade. This approach allows you to control the intensity of the color and avoid ending up with dough that is too dark or overpowering. Additionally, consider the impact of other ingredients in the dough, as some elements like vanilla extract or cocoa powder can affect the final color outcome.
Lastly, the temperature at which you mix the coloring agents into the dough can also influence the vibrancy of the colors. For optimal results, mix the natural coloring agents into the dough when it is at room temperature. This allows the colors to blend evenly and develop their full vibrancy. Storage And Preservation Of Colored Cookie Dough
After putting in the effort to color your cookie dough naturally, it is important to store it properly to maintain its freshness and vibrant colors. To preserve the colored cookie dough,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or place it in an airtight container. Make sure to press out any air pockets to prevent the dough from drying out or developing freezer burn.
For short-term storage, you can keep the colored cookie dough in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. If you plan on using it beyond that timeframe, freezing is the best option. The frozen dough can be stored for up to 3 months. When ready to use, allow the dough to thaw in the refrigerator overnight before shaping and baking.

How Can I Achieve Different Shades Of Colors Using Natural Ingredients?
To achieve different shades of colors using natural ingredients, you can experiment with various plant-based materials such as fruits, vegetables, herbs, and spices. For example, boiling beets can create a deep pink color, while turmeric powder can produce a vibrant yellow. By adjusting the quantity of the natural ingredients used, the duration of boiling or soaking, and even mixing different ingredients together, you can create a wide range of hues. Additionally, adding acidic or alkaline agents like vinegar or baking soda can alter the colors produced, giving you even more options for achieving different shades naturally.

Can You Provide Tips For Getting The Best Results When Naturally Coloring Cookie Dough?
When naturally coloring cookie dough, start with high-quality natural food coloring like beetroot powder, matcha powder, or turmeric for vibrant hues. Gradually add the coloring agent to the dough to control the intensity of the color. It’s important to not overdo the coloring to maintain the texture and flavor of the cookies.
Additionally, consider the impact of the ingredients on the final color. For instance, acidic ingredients like lemon juice may alter the color, so adjust the coloring accordingly. Chilling the dough before baking can also help the colors set and prevent them from fading during baking, resulting in beautifully colored cookies.
